OVERVIEW OF TÜRK TELEKOM

Türk Telekom, with more than 180 years of history, is the first integrated telecommunications operator in Türkiye. In 2015, Company adopted a customer-oriented and integrated structure in order to respond to the rapidly changing communication and technology needs of customers in the most powerful and accurate way, while maintaining the legal entities of TT Mobil İletişim Hizmetleri A.Ş. and TTNET A.Ş. intact and adhering to the rules and regulations to which they are subject. Having a wide service network and product range in the fields of individual and corporate services, Türk Telekom unified its mobile, internet, phone and TV products and services under the single "Türk Telekom" brand as of January 2016.

"Türkiye's Multiplay Provider" Türk Telekom has 17.4 million fixed access lines, 15.3 million broadband, 3.2 million TV and 27 million mobile subscribers as of September 30, 2024. Türk Telekom Group Companies provide services in all 81 cities of Türkiye with 36,323 employees with the vision of introducing new technologies to Türkiye and accelerating Türkiye's transformation into an information society.

The share transfer between LYY Telekomünikasyon A.Ş. (LYY) and Türkiye Wealth Fund (TWF), for the sale of Türk Telekomünikasyon A.Ş.'s (Türk Telekom) 55% stake owned by LYY to TWF is completed as of March 31, 2022. Accordingly, TWF has become the majority shareholder of Türk Telekom with a 61.68% stake.

The Türk Telekom Shareholders' Agreement and the Articles of Association further state that the Turkish Treasury owns a "golden share" (Class C share). The "golden share" is entitled to nominate a Board Member and has the below rights as per article 6 of the Articles of Association;

"In order to protect Türkiye's national interests relating to national security and the economy, the Class C share's positive vote is required for the following matters regardless of the voting result in the Board or General Assembly, otherwise accepted as null and void."

  • a) Any proposed amendments to the Articles of Association;
  • b) The transfer of any of the Company's registered shares which would result in a change in management control;
  • c) The registration of any transfer of the Company's registered shares in the shareholder ledger.

FINANCIAL RISK MANAGEMENT

Türk Telekom can be exposed to financial risks such as liquidity risk, currency risk, interest rate risk, and counterparty risk.

Within the framework of the strategy to minimise the liquidity risk, long-term financial debt is obtained from different geographical regions (the Americas, Canada, Europe, the Gulf, Japan, China, and Türkiye) and from a diversified pool of creditors (commercial banks, international financial institutions, official export credit agencies, and bond markets).This strategy enables the Group to have access to long-term financing on competitive terms, without being dependent on a limited group of funding sources.

With regard to the Eurobonds issued by Türk Telekom, the Group actively monitors the price and return dynamics of these bonds, which are tradeable instruments in the secondary markets in order to ensure optimal cash management strategy on total return and cost basis.

The need to partially procure supplies in relation to capital expenditures from foreign vendors and the need for financing through long-term and diversified funding sources cause Türk Telekom to bear liabilities in foreign currency. Hence, excluding the hedge transactions, Türk Telekom has net liabilities in foreign currency and is exposed to FX risk due to the fluctuations in exchange rates, which may have an impact on the financial statements.

Türk Telekom aims to keep the impact of FX exposure on the financial statements to a minimum with its FX risk management transactions. In this respect, Türk Telekom has a total hedge position of USD 1,7231 million equivalent, details of which are provided in the footnotes of its audited financial statements. The total hedge position including the cash in hard currency, which provides a natural hedge against FX exposure is USD 1,838 million equivalent.

With regards to its financial assets, Türk Telekom aims to minimise the counterparty risk in accordance with the established counterparty limits and diversification policy. Türk Telekom carries out its hedge transactions regarding financial risks within the framework of the guidance and authorisation set by the Board of Directors.

1 Hedged amount includes hedging of FX financial debt, currency protected time deposit, hedging of FX net trade payables and net investment hedge. Currency protected time deposit included in hedged amount is worth USD 258 mn.

Our short FX position was USD 8 million by year-end. Excluding the ineffective portion of the hedge portfolio, namely the PCCS contracts, foreign currency exposure was USD 191 million short FX position.

13 August 2024 Dated Regulatory Disclosure - JCR Eurasia Rating Annual Review Announcement

JCR Eurasia Rating (JCR), concluded its annual review for Türk Telekomünikasyon A.Ş. and considered our Company in the investment grade category. JCR affirmed our Company's Long-Term National Issuer Credit Rating at "AAA (tr)" and the Short-Term National Issuer Credit Rating at "J1+ (tr)" with "Stable" outlooks.

JCR, affirmed our Company's Long Term International Foreign and Local Currency Issuer Credit Rating as "BB" and revised the outlook to "Stable" from "Negative", in line with the international rating outlooks of the Republic of Türkiye.

19 September 2024 Dated Regulatory Disclosure - Fitch Ratings Revised Türk Telekomünikasyon A.Ş.'s Corporate Ratings and Outlooks

On September 6, 2024, Fitch Ratings upgraded Türkiye's Long-Term Foreign-Currency Issuer Default Rating (IDR) from "B+" to "BB-", with a "Stable" outlook. In accordance, Fitch Ratings upgraded Türk Telekom's Long-Term local and foreign currency IDRs from 'B+' to 'BB-' with a "Stable" outlook.

Fitch has also upgraded the Türk Telekom's senior unsecured instrument ratings to 'BB-'/'RR4'.
